The soil of village **Dhanoli** still had the same sweet smell, which was once associated with Anika's childhood memories. Tall mango trees, crops swaying in the fields, bullock carts bouncing on the unpaved roads - everything was the same as before. Only, time had moved on… and with it some relationships had also changed.


Today, after five years, Anika had returned to this village. Somewhere between the glitz and busy life of the city, her mind often wandered to the streets of this village. And now that she was here, everything started feeling like her own again.


But the thing that she was feeling the most was **Raghav**.


The same boy from the village, who used to laugh at everything, who used to sit under the shade of a tree and tell stories to his friends, the same Raghav, with whom her untold love was associated.


### **A childhood relationship that could never be expressed…**


The laughter of the boys sitting in the village square was echoing. Some farmers were returning from the fields with their ploughs hanging on their shoulders. Meanwhile, Anika looked around – and saw that Raghav was sitting under the same tree.


The same carefree style, the same light smile, as if time had not touched him.


The old days flashed in Anika’s eyes. How many times she and Raghav had sat together at this very place, had made a bet to throw the mango seeds, sometimes quarreled, sometimes talked for hours… but then it was friendship. Or maybe something more than that… but both of them never said it openly.


Today, when she returned after five years, would anything have changed?


Just then, Raghav’s eyes fell on Anika.


Everything stopped for a moment.


Raghav got up and came towards her. **"How did you remember the village after so many years?"** There was a slight sarcasm in his voice, but there was something else in his eyes- maybe a question, maybe a complaint.


Anika tried to smile forcibly. **"That's it… I had left something incomplete, I have come to complete it."**


Raghav took a deep breath. **"We too were left incomplete, Anika…"**


The cold breeze of the village was hinting at a new story.
